Teachers in pre-primary education, female in Switzerland
Switzerland: Teachers in pre-primary education, female was 14,403 number in 2018. ▲ Rising
Teachers in pre-primary education, female in Switzerland, 2012–2018
Source: UNESCO Institute for Statistics. Measured in number.
Analysis
Switzerland recorded 14,403 number for teachers in pre-primary education, female in 2018. That is the highest value across all 6 years on record.
The figure is up 0.2% on the previous year and up 17.3% over ten years.
Switzerland ranks 63rd of 179 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

About this data
Total number of female teachers in public and private pre-primary education institutions. Teachers are persons employed full time or part time in an official capacity to guide and direct the learning experience of pupils and students, irrespective of their qualifications or the delivery mechanism, i.e. face-to-face and/or at a distance. This definition excludes educational personnel who have no active teaching duties (e.g. headmasters, headmistresses or principals who do not teach) and persons who work occasionally or in a voluntary capacity in educational institutions.
